I found a great deal on 35s for 15in rims but I want to make sure I will be able to fit on my 96 cruiser before I pull the trigger, I know I will have to run a spacer (preferably 1in or 1.25in)
Wheel Specs:
Pro Comp 252 Series
  • Wheel Size: 15x8
  • Backspace: 3.75
  • Offset: -19
 
You’ll have to run like a 4 inch spacer.
 
Really 😬. Ive heard on other forums 1in would work
The brake calipers won't clear, would have to push the wheel out far enough so they are outside it. Spacer size dependent on back spacing. Wheels with less backspacing will take less spacer.
